Effector RF Products is responsible for designing RF and Microwave hardware, including transmitters, receivers, and exciters. This includes design and test activities that span preliminary design to integration. Products we develop support radar and datalink applications on a variety of tactical missile programs. Critical to this role is designing for challenging mechanical constraints and extreme environments. This position is an onsite role, located in Tucson, AZ.
